ABSTRACT

The details of the design of sewers are presented in this chapter. The relationships between partial flow parameters are presented and further illustrated with solved example problems. Example problems also include the determination of partial flow depth and flow velocity under low flow conditions. Flow equations for various flow conditions are analyzed and typical designs are demonstrated. The maximum, minimum and self-cleansing velocity of flow is defined and the mathematical relationships for partially full pipes are established. The chapter ends with a section on storm drainage. The Rational Method formula as it applies to urban drainage is detailed and example problems are included.
